Transaction 141f86202f9bf7bcef57eece02f30d56dfadd2e1a0479294c58edca13ce96e40
2 Input
2 Outputs
- 141f86202f9bf7bcef57eece02f30d56dfadd2e1a0479294c58edca13ce96e40:0
- 141f86202f9bf7bcef57eece02f30d56dfadd2e1a0479294c58edca13ce96e40:1
value 739728
address 14ytmUwHXzdjwypHVGVXYP2DFG2xurr4w6
value 2483000
address 13WQKbmxAtwXA35A7kk4ocxmDgh3M4GTAD